Description

Swift's ideal home

Golden oldie Swift has found himself back in our care for no fault of his own. He's found coming into the centre a little bit scary and overwhelming but is slowly learning to make some new friends. He's on the search for a quiet and peaceful retirement home where he can enjoy gentle walks and snoozes in a lovely comfy bed. Swift can live with adults only and will need to be the only pet, however he could share his walks with polite and calm doggies who aren't going to be too in his face. Swift has spent a long time in a home where he has been housetrained and happy being left for a few hours, however this may all need a little refresh when he's settled back into home life. His new family will need to be able to visit him a few time so that he can build a relationship and get to know you before he heads off home. Swift is currently learning to wear a muzzle for when he visits the vet as isn't a fan of too much handling.

Could you be Swift's perfect match?

Swift is a little bit chunky at the moment and undergoing a strict weight loss plan and is on a special diet. He's slowly loosing weight and is already feeling much happier! As an older boy he does have some ongoing medical needs, including arthritis which he currently on pain relief for. This will need to be monitored and continued in his forever home.

Border Collie Buying Checklist

We highly recommend every buyer reads through the below advice when purchasing or rehoming a Border Collie.

  • View the animal in the place it was born and raised - check for genuine home environments if buying privately, or the quality of the breeders set-up if applicable.
  • If viewing a puppy under 6 months, by law they MUST be seen with their mum.
  • Make sure the animal's old enough to be rehomed. 8 weeks should be the earliest a puppy can be rehomed.
  • By law, all dogs MUST be microchipped

Avoid Potential Scams

There are a number of red flags to look out for when purchasing a new puppy:

  • Seller demands a deposit without allowing you to see the dog first - never send any money before meeting the animal in person
  • Seller is reluctant to send you additional photos or videos
  • Seller offers to deliver the dog/puppy
  • Seller asks to meet in a mutual location
  • Seller uses fake or stolen photos from the internet. Always carry out a "Google image search".

Although we have a number of automated systems in place to prevent scam and fraudulant adverts, these can never be 100% accurate and its important to use caution when buying online.
